Welcome to the Experiment. Growing up shooting short Super 8 movies in Toronto's High Park, Vincenzo Natali and Andre Bijelic exploded onto the international fi lm scene with 1997's Cube, a sci-fi /horror fi lm about six people trapped in a maze of death; its repercussions are still being felt cinematically today.

Cube: Inside the Making of a Cult Film Classic reveals the complete story of how these childhood friends brought a convincing, futuristic vision of hell to the big screen for less than $1 million in Canada, far from the Hollywood studio system. From the fi rst spark of inspiration to the development of the script and its shooting, you'll follow the fi lmmakers through the triumphs, mathematics, mutinies and elations they experienced along the way. Also inside, director Natali opens up his Cube archives to share:


Storyboards
Character sketches
Behind the scenes photos
Unused Cube traps
Early script excerpts
and much more
